On 2013-12-01 at 21:34 -0500, Phil Pennock wrote:
> I looked first for a documentation-server and didn't see anything
> readily suitable, without repo commit access to configure it. I think
> that a better solution is probably to use <https://readthedocs.org/> and
> point to the documentation there.
Hrm, I was under the impression that readthedocs supported various input
documentation formats, and that sphinx was similarly flexible.
Apparently I was wrong on both counts. It has to be Sphinx, and Sphinx
only appears to accept reStructuredText, so I can't shove POD into it.
This was my mistake. I've gone ahead and deleted the readthedocs.org
project for SKS.
If anyone knows of a similar documentation hosting project which might
be a better match, please do let me know.
(I mostly use GitHub and/or godoc.org for my current work).
